Weather in September

September, the first month of the spring in Idsowe, is still a warm month, with temperature in the range of an average high of 28.1°C (82.6°F) and an average low of 24.2°C (75.6°F).

Temperature

Idsowe records an average high-temperature of a still warm 28.1°C (82.6°F) in September, closely mirroring the climate of the previous month. Throughout September, Idsowe reports a steady low-temperature average of 24.2°C (75.6°F), slightly lower than its daytime counterpart.

Heat index

The average heat index in September is appraised at a tropical 32°C (89.6°F). If exposure and activity are sustained, they might cause a feeling of weariness, resulting in heat cramps.
Take note of the fact that heat index values are based on shaded circumstances with light airflows. The heat index may experience an enhancement of 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ees under direct sunlight.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', reflects the blend of air temperature and relative humidity to give a temperature impression. Additional elements including metabolic differences, the level of physical activity, and attire have a role in shaping the individual's temperature perception. Always consider that direct sunlight exposure might heighten the heat's effects, pushing the heat index up by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are largely significant for babies and toddlers. Kids frequently fail to realize the necessity for resting and hydrating. Thirst is an advanced indication of dehydration - hence, maintaining hydration, especially during extended physical activities, becomes essential.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in September is 75%.

Rainfall

In Idsowe, in September, during 12.6 rainfall days, 19mm (0.75") of precipitation is typically accumulated. In Idsowe, during the entire year, the rain falls for 192.5 days and collects up to 641mm (25.24") of precipitation.

Daylight

The average length of the day in September is 12h and 6min.
On the first day of September, sunrise is at 06:17 and sunset at 18:21.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:05 and sunset at 18:13 EAT.

Sunshine

In September, the average sunshine is 8.8h.

Average temperature in September
Idsowe, Kenya

Average temperature in September - Idsowe, Kenya
  • Average high temperature in September: 28.1°C

The warmest month (with the highest average high temperature) is March (31.3°C).
The month with the lowest average high temperature is August (27.4°C).

  • Average low temperature in September: 24.2°C

The month with the highest average low temperature is April (26.7°C).
The coldest month (with the lowest average low temperature) is August (24°C).

Average rainfall in September
Idsowe, Kenya

Average rainfall in September - Idsowe, Kenya
  • Average rainfall in September: 19mm

The wettest month (with the highest rainfall) is May (156mm).
The driest month (with the least rainfall) is February (7mm).

[Resources]

Average rainfall days in September
Idsowe, Kenya

Average rainfall days in September - Idsowe, Kenya
  • Average rainfall days in September: 12.6 days

The month with the highest number of rainy days is May (24.4 days).
The month with the least rainy days is February (3.6 days).
